Describe Selye's General Adaptation Syndrome.

संक्षेप में उत्तर

उत्तर

Gives importance to physiological factors in stress GAS involves three stages: alarm reaction, resistance, and exhaustion.

  1. Alarm reaction stage: The presence of a noxious stimulus or stressor leads to activation of the adrenal pituitary-cortex system. This triggers the release of hormones, producing the stress response. Now, the individual is ready for fight or flight.
  2. Resistance stage: If stress is prolonged, the resistance stage begins. The parasympathetic nervous system calls for more cautious use of the body’s resources. The organism makes efforts to cope with the threat as through confrontation.
  3. Exhaustion stage: Continued exposure to the same or additional stressors drains the body of its resources and leads to the third stage of exhaustion. The physiological systems involved in alarm reaction and resistance become ineffective, and susceptibility to stress-related diseases such as high blood pressure becomes more likely.
